Which of the following could be an indication of a fight occurring in a public space?

Noise Complaints

Noise complaints could serve as a clear indication that a fight is occurring in a public space. When individuals are engaged in an altercation, it often leads to elevated voices, shouting, and commotion that may disturb nearby residents or passersby. This disruption can trigger concerns among community members, prompting them to report the noise to law enforcement or local authorities.

In contrast, authorized gatherings, peaceful assemblies, and civil discussions are generally characterized by cooperation and order, which would not typically generate noise complaints. These types of activities usually adhere to regulations and maintain a respectful environment, making them less likely to be perceived as problematic or violent in nature. Thus, noise complaints serve as a distinct signal that something disruptive, such as a fight, may be taking place.
